Medication delivery apparatus
First Claim
1. A fluid delivery apparatus for automatically infusing medication into a patient, the apparatus comprising a cartridge formed of a laminate of a first material and a second material which bonded together at predetermined areas to form a plurality of separate chambers that are each configured to be filled with a respective fluid for infusion into a patient upon the application of pressure on the respective chamber, wherein each of said separate chambers includes an exit port having a length and an effective radius formed between the bonded areas that results in fluid flowing from the respective chamber through the exit port at a predetermined rate for delivery to the patient in response to the application of a predetermined pressure on the respective chamber, and, means for applying the predetermined pressure to the respective chambers in a predetermined sequence for infusing the respective fluids into the patient in accordance with the predetermined sequence.

Abstract
It is a primary object of the present invention to provide an automated system based on an integral fluid bag for administering a variety of intravenous drug regimens and reducing the vagaries of existing manual systems. The fluid has multiple chambers configured to implement a prescribed intravenous medical therapy. Each chamber'"'"'s geometry (size, shape), sequence and position, alone and in combination with the other chambers, matches the prescribed intravenous therapy or drug regimen. The bag'"'"'s configuration assures that the intravenous therapy is administered in accordance with the prescribed drug regimen, thus automating the previous manual method. A choice of fluid bag configurations may be stocked so that a prescription for well known and widely accepted drug regimens may be filled by merely selecting a bag with the appropriate chamber configuration and filling it with the prescribed medications.
